ISP - Internet Service Providers in Timberville

MisterWhat found 2 results for ISP - Internet Service Providers in Timberville.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Service Kings
297 New Market Rd
Timberville, 22853
Timberville Electronics Inc
297 New Market Rd
Timberville, 22853

Related results

Bowman Apple Products Co Inc
17851 Mechanicsville Rd
Timberville, 22853